Precision plastic moulds represent the cornerstone of efficient, high-volume manufacturing for automotive and white goods industries. Engineered with exacting standards, these moulds transform raw plastic materials into consistent, high-tolerance components through injection molding processes. Each mould is designed to withstand continuous production cycles while maintaining dimensional stability and surface quality. The construction utilizes premium-grade steels and specialized surface treatments to resist wear, corrosion, and thermal stress. This focus on durability ensures consistent part quality across millions of cycles, reducing variation and minimizing production rejects. Manufacturers benefit from predictable performance that integrates seamlessly with automated production lines and quality control systems.

The automotive industry relies on these precision moulds for both interior and exterior vehicle components. Interior applications include dashboard assemblies, center consoles, door panels, and trim pieces that require Class A surface finishes and precise fitment. Exterior components such as bumper fascias, grilles, wheel arch liners, and mirror housings demand weather resistance, impact strength, and consistent color matching. White goods manufacturers utilize these moulds for refrigerator liners that maintain thermal properties, washing machine tubs that withstand mechanical stress, and air conditioner housings that provide structural support. Engineering sectors employ them for electrical enclosures, mechanical gears, and specialized components where dimensional accuracy directly impacts product functionality and safety compliance.

Key Features:
- High-precision engineering for consistent dimensional accuracy across production runs
- Durable construction using corrosion-resistant steels and specialized surface treatments
- Optimized cooling and ejection systems for efficient cycle times and part release
- Designed for specific plastic materials including ABS, polypropylene, polycarbonate, and engineering grades
- Standardized mounting interfaces for easy integration with injection molding machines
